摘要
In this paper, an optical fiber interferometric displacement sensor array based on time division multiplexing (TDM) is proposed for translation and tilt metrology of gravitational reference sensor (GRS). To effectively reduce the sampling rate, a carrier signal extraction method based on non-uniform sampling is proposed and demonstrated. Experimental result reveals that the sampling rate of 65 MS/s is enough to demodulate the heterodyne carrier signal from a pulse with width of 10 ns, which is 15 times lower than the traditional sampling method.
